Scenario 2 Speed change examples
1. Speeding up Increasing vessel speed to
pass ahead of the target vessel. Proceed with
caution, there is always an inherent risk when
passing in front of other vessels.
2. No change Not changing speed or course is
not recommended as it may result in a collision.
3. Slowing down Slowing down slightly may
result in the 2 Interception zones closing up or
merging into a single zone.
4. Slowing down Slowing down a sufcient
amount will allow the target vessel to pass safely
ahead of your vessel, avoiding the Interception
zone(s).
Example scenario 3— Both vessels
travelling at the same speed
Note: These scenarios are examples provided for
guidance only.
Course change
When both vessels are travelling at the same speed,
course alterations should be made in accordance
with the guidance provided in examples 1 and 2.
Speed change
When both vessels are travelling at the same speed,
altering your speed will change the collision scenario
to one of the scenarios detailed in examples 1 and 2.
Enabling Target interception
Target interception graphics are disabled by
default; they can be enabled from the Target
interceptions page, which is accessible from the
Chart application’s menu.
1. Ensure the AIS Overlay is enabled.
The AIS Overlay can be enabled from the
Overlays menu (Menu > Presentation >
Overlays).
2. Open the Target Interception page: (Menu >
Radar & AIS > Collision Avoidance > Target
Interceptions, or Menu > AIS > Collision
Avoidance > Target Interceptions).
3. Select the slider control so that On is displayed.
4. Select the distance ahead box and select the
required Intercept distance.
5. Select Back or Close to return to the previous
menu or Chart application screen.
Target interception graphics will now be displayed
for all AIS targets that will cross your current course
within the specied Intercept distance, based on
your current speed and the target’s course and
speed derived from their AIS data.
Showing Target interception for
individual targets
Target interception graphics can be displayed
for individual targets that you want to track or
rendez-vous with.
1. Ensure that the AIS Overlay is enabled.
The AIS Overlay can be enabled from the
Overlays menu (Menu > Presentation >
Overlays).
2. Select an AIS target.
3. From the context menu select Show
Interceptions so that On is selected.
